Meizu MX with a quad-core processor might launch by the end of September

0. phoneArena posted on 20 Sep 2011, 03:55

The Chinese manufacturer Meizu is planning on releasing its Meizu MX Android smartphone in both dual- and quad-core versions with 16 and 32 gigs of on-board storage respectively. Since the...
